How To Fix /ACCGO/NS_STL062 - Cannot create settlement document for washout settlement


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/ACCGO/NS_STL -

  • Message number: 062

  • Message text: Cannot create settlement document for washout settlement

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/ACCGO/NS_STL062 - Cannot create settlement document for washout settlement ?

    The SAP error message /ACCGO/NS_STL062 Cannot create settlement document for washout settlement typically occurs in the context of the SAP system when dealing with settlement processes, particularly in the area of financial accounting and controlling. This error is related to the washout settlement process, which is used to settle costs and revenues in specific scenarios, such as internal orders or projects.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Configuration: The error may arise if the necessary configuration for washout settlements is not properly set up in the system. This includes settings related to settlement profiles, settlement rules, or the specific characteristics of the order or project being settled.

    2. Inconsistent Data: There may be inconsistencies in the data related to the order or project, such as missing or incorrect master data, which can prevent the creation of the settlement document.

    3. Settlement Rules: If the settlement rules defined for the order or project do not allow for washout settlements, this error can occur.

    4. Authorization Issues: Sometimes, the user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the settlement, leading to this error.

    5. Technical Issues: There could be underlying technical issues, such as problems with the database or the application server, that prevent the settlement document from being created.

    Solution:

    1. Check Configuration: Review the configuration settings for washout settlements in the SAP system. Ensure that the settlement profiles and rules are correctly defined and that they allow for washout settlements.

    2. Validate Data: Check the master data and transactional data related to the order or project. Ensure that all required fields are filled out correctly and that there are no inconsistencies.

    3. Review Settlement Rules: Verify the settlement rules associated with the order or project. Make sure that they are set up to allow for washout settlements.

    4. User Authorizations: Ensure that the user attempting to perform the settlement has the necessary authorizations. If not, work with your SAP security team to grant the required permissions.

    5. Check Logs and Messages: Look at the application logs and messages for more detailed information about the error. This can provide insights into what specifically is causing the issue.

    6.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ific error message for additional troubleshooting steps or known issues.

    7.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ance. They may have additional insights or patches available for your specific version of SAP.
